What Is a Warehouse Racking System?
A warehouse racking system is a structured storage framework designed to organize, stack, and store goods in a way that maximizes vertical space and improves operational efficiency. These systems range from simple shelving units to complex multi-level pallet rack configurations built for heavy industrial loads.
In Pakistan, racking systems are used across industries including FMCG, pharmaceuticals, automotive, agriculture, chemicals, and retail. Choosing the right type depends on your product type, load weight, warehouse dimensions, and budget.

Types of Warehouse Racking Systems Available in Pakistan
1. Pallet Racks
Pallet racks are the backbone of most large warehouses in Pakistan. Designed to store palletized goods, these systems allow forklifts to access individual pallet positions from the aisle making them ideal for high-volume storage and retrieval operations.
Best for: Distributors, logistics companies, FMCG warehouses, and cold storage facilities.
Key features:
- High load-bearing capacity (up to several tons per level)
- Adjustable beam heights for flexible storage
- Compatible with both forklifts and pallet jacks
- Available in selective, double-deep, drive-in, and push-back configurations

2. Heavy Duty Racks with Shelves
When you need to store large quantities of heavy items from machinery parts to bulk raw materials heavy-duty racks with shelves are the go-to solution. These are reinforced steel structures built for environments where safety and reliability are non-negotiable.
Best for: Factories, industrial stores, manufacturing facilities, and spare parts warehouses.
Key features:
- Built with thick-gauge steel for maximum structural integrity
- Supports extremely high load capacities per shelf
- Can be customized with different shelf depths and bay widths
- Available in bolt-based and boltless configurations
3. Boltless Racks
Boltless racks (also known as rivet shelving or snap-fit racks) are highly versatile and easy to assemble without any specialized tools. The shelves simply snap into the upright posts using metal clips or rivets making setup and reconfiguration a breeze.
Best for: Retail backrooms, light industrial storage, offices, garages, and smaller warehouses.
Key features:
- Quick assembly and disassembly no bolts or tools required
- Adjustable shelf heights
- Cost-effective option for lighter loads
- Clean, modern appearance suitable for retail environments

4. Cantilever Racks
Cantilever racks are the right choice when you’re storing long, bulky, or irregularly shaped items that don’t fit on standard shelves. These racks feature extended arms projecting from a central column creating open storage bays with no front column obstruction.
Best for: Timber yards, steel distributors, furniture manufacturers, pipe and conduit storage, and building material suppliers.
Key features:
- Unobstructed access for long or oversized items
- Arms are adjustable for different load lengths
- Available in single-sided and double-sided configurations
- Can be combined with overhead cranes for heavy lifting
5. Drum Racks and Drum Storage Shelves
Storing chemical drums, barrels, or industrial containers safely requires specialized solutions. Drum racks are purpose-built to hold cylindrical containers securely, preventing rolling and spillage a critical safety requirement in chemical, oil, and manufacturing environments.
Best for: Chemical plants, oil storage facilities, paint manufacturers, and pharmaceutical warehouses.
Key features:
- Designed for safe horizontal or vertical drum storage
- Spill containment features available
- Sturdy construction to withstand the weight of filled drums
- Compliant with industrial safety standards
6. Supermarket Racks
Supermarket racks are not just for grocery stores. These sleek, retail-friendly shelving systems are used in supermarkets, pharmacies, convenience stores, and departmental stores across Pakistan. They’re designed for easy product display, quick restocking, and clear visibility for shoppers.
Best for: Retail outlets, supermarkets, pharmacies, and convenience stores.
Key features:
- Gondola-style shelving for double-sided use
- Adjustable shelves for flexible product display
- Available in various sizes and finishes
- Easy to install and rearrange as inventory changes

7. Mezzanine Floors and Mobile Shelving
For warehouses with high ceilings and limited floor area, mezzanine floors create an entirely new level of usable storage space essentially building a “second floor” within your existing facility. Mobile shelving systems, on the other hand, use tracks to allow aisles to open only where needed, dramatically compressing storage into a smaller footprint.
Best for: E-commerce fulfillment centers, archival storage, pharmaceutical warehouses, and any facility looking to double its capacity without relocating.

How to Choose the Right Racking System in Pakistan
With so many options available, how do you pick the right one? Here’s a simple framework:
Step 1 Define your load profile. What are you storing? How heavy are individual items or pallets? Light goods need light shelving; heavy industrial stock needs reinforced steel.
Step 2 Map your space. Measure your floor area, ceiling height, door widths, and column positions. Share this with your racking supplier so they can design an optimal layout.
Step 3 Consider your picking method. Do forklifts operate in your facility? If yes, pallet racks are likely the right choice. If stock is picked manually, shelving or boltless systems may work better.
Step 4 Factor in safety and compliance. Industrial racking must meet load capacity and safety standards. Work with suppliers who provide engineered, tested systems.
Step 5 Think long-term. Choose a system that can be expanded or reconfigured as your business grows. Modular systems give you that flexibility.

Warehouse Racking Installation: What to Expect
Buying racks is only part of the process. Proper installation is equally important for safety and performance. Here’s what a professional installation typically involves:
Site survey: Your supplier visits the warehouse to assess dimensions, floor conditions, column positions, and workflow patterns.
Custom layout design: Engineers create a rack layout that maximizes storage density while maintaining safe aisle widths and access points.
Delivery and assembly: Rack components are delivered and assembled by a trained installation team.
Load testing and safety check: After installation, load capacity is verified and the system is inspected for structural integrity.
Handover and training: Staff are briefed on safe loading practices, weight limits, and inspection protocols.

Q6. How do I know if my racking system is overloaded?
Look for visible signs such as bent or bowing beams, twisted uprights, misaligned frames, or unusual creaking sounds. Each rack system comes with a rated load capacity never exceed it. Regular inspections by trained personnel are essential.

Q8. What’s the difference between pallet racks and heavy-duty shelving?
Pallet racks are designed specifically for forklift operations and store goods on pallets. Heavy-duty shelving with shelves is more suited for manual access to individual items, spare parts, or equipment where picking is done by hand rather than by a forklift.
Q9. How long do industrial racks last?
With proper installation, regular maintenance, and correct usage (not exceeding load limits), quality industrial racks can last 20 to 30 years or more. The key is buying from a reputable manufacturer and ensuring racks are not abused by overloading or forklift damage.
Q10. Do I need professional installation for warehouse racks?
For light-duty boltless shelving, self-installation is possible. However, for heavy-duty pallet racks, cantilever systems, or mezzanine floors, professional installation is strongly recommended to ensure structural safety and compliance with load specifications.
